#9c0d71 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#9c0d71 is composed of 61.2% red, 5.1% green and 44.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 91.7% magenta, 27.6% yellow and 38.8% black. It has a hue angle of 318 degrees, a saturation of 84.6% and a lightness of 33.1%. #9c0d71 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ff1ae2 with #390000. Closest websafe color is: #990066.

#9c0d71 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#9c0d71 has RGB values of R:156, G:13, B:113 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.92, Y:0.28, K:0.39. Its decimal value is 10227057.

Hex triplet 9c0d71 #9c0d71
RGB Decimal 156, 13, 113 rgb(156,13,113)
RGB Percent 61.2, 5.1, 44.3 rgb(61.2%,5.1%,44.3%)
CMYK 0, 92, 28, 39
HSL 318°, 84.6, 33.1 hsl(318,84.6%,33.1%)
HSV (or HSB) 318°, 91.7, 61.2
Web Safe 990066 #990066
CIE-LAB 35.102, 60.53, -18.274
XYZ 16.835, 8.55, 16.386
xyY 0.403, 0.205, 8.55
CIE-LCH 35.102, 63.229, 343.201
CIE-LUV 35.102, 67.926, -32.941
Hunter-Lab 29.24, 51.603, -12.758
Binary 10011100, 00001101, 01110001

Shades and Tints of #9c0d71

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0108 is the darkest color, while #fef8f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#9c0d71

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5b4e57 is the less saturated color, while #a90076 is the most saturated one.
